diff --git a/Dockerfile b/Dockerfile index 2539d9e1..50077cca 100644 --- a/Dockerfile +++ b/Dockerfile @@ -17,4 +17,4 @@ EXPOSE 80 COPY docker_config.json /.filebrowser.json COPY filebrowser /filebrowser -ENTRYPOINT [ "/filebrowser" ] \ No newline at end of file +ENTRYPOINT [ "/filebrowser" ] diff --git a/Dockerfile.s6 b/Dockerfile.s6 index 2bba24d6..9e4a1e9d 100644 --- a/Dockerfile.s6 +++ b/Dockerfile.s6 @@ -14,4 +14,4 @@ COPY filebrowser /usr/bin/filebrowser # ports and volumes VOLUME /srv /config /database -EXPOSE 80 \ No newline at end of file +EXPOSE 80 diff --git a/cmd/root.go b/cmd/root.go index f08ea498..a40a923d 100644 --- a/cmd/root.go +++ b/cmd/root.go @@ -337,6 +337,9 @@ func quickSetup(flags *pflag.FlagSet, d pythonData) { Download: true, Torrent: true, }, + CreateBody: users.CreateTorrentBody{ + Date: true, + }, }, AuthMethod: "", Branding: settings.Branding{}, diff --git a/cmd/users.go b/cmd/users.go index 69241010..7a604f5a 100644 --- a/cmd/users.go +++ b/cmd/users.go @@ -78,7 +78,7 @@ func addUserFlags(flags *pflag.FlagSet) { flags.String("locale", "en", "locale for users") flags.String("viewMode", string(users.ListViewMode), "view mode for users") flags.Bool("singleClick", false, "use single clicks only") - flags.String("trackerListsUrl", "https://cf.trackerslist.com/all.txt", "tracker lists url") + flags.String("trackersListUrl", "https://cf.trackerslist.com/all.txt", "tracker lists url") } func getViewMode(flags *pflag.FlagSet) users.ViewMode { diff --git a/cmd/users_update.go b/cmd/users_update.go index 822bb6dc..2ee54e24 100644 --- a/cmd/users_update.go +++ b/cmd/users_update.go @@ -48,6 +48,7 @@ options you want to change.`, Perm: user.Perm, Sorting: user.Sorting, Commands: user.Commands, + CreateBody: user.CreateBody, } getUserDefaults(flags, &defaults, false) user.Scope = defaults.Scope @@ -57,6 +58,7 @@ options you want to change.`, user.Perm = defaults.Perm user.Commands = defaults.Commands user.Sorting = defaults.Sorting + user.CreateBody = defaults.CreateBody user.LockPassword = mustGetBool(flags, "lockPassword") if newUsername != "" { diff --git a/frontend/src/api/torrent.ts b/frontend/src/api/torrent.ts index ba63309b..16cecf9d 100644 --- a/frontend/src/api/torrent.ts +++ b/frontend/src/api/torrent.ts @@ -1,5 +1,10 @@ import { fetchURL, fetchJSON, removePrefix, createURL } from "./utils"; +export async function fetchDefaultOptions() { + const url = `/api/torrent` + return fetchJSON(url); +} + export async function makeTorrent( url: string, announces: string[], diff --git a/frontend/src/components/prompts/Publish.vue b/frontend/src/components/prompts/Publish.vue index e4835fc0..4f8d4fc5 100644 --- a/frontend/src/components/prompts/Publish.vue +++ b/frontend/src/components/prompts/Publish.vue @@ -2,7 +2,7 @@
- {{ $t("prompts.publishMessageSingle") }} + {{ $t("prompts.publishMessage") }}